The spell does wonders as Roland practically flies into motion, his legs carrying him swiftly into a rush of strikes on the first troll he encounters. He silently thanks Tidus for the boost, but he isn't allowed to linger long on that thought. The troll blocks him easily with giant, beefy arms scaled and mutated. He holds out for a moment, trying to strongarm the troll with the widest part of his sword, but it's the troll in the middle that he has to watch out for; blighted with uncontrollable rage. Its roar is deafening up close, but its the wide, downwards arc of his club that alerts Roland to move, move, move! He breaks the parlay between the troll that absorbs his first set of attacks and jumps in the nick of time, backwards into a crouch with his free hand grazing the rocky ground to help him keep steady.
Unfortunately, he has little room to get his bearings. He cringes in mild frustration as all three now attempt to crowd him, the ground shaking with the force of their combined stampede. Their bodies block his view from Tidus, cutting off visual communication. But in the window of time he has left, Roland throws his voice over, hoping the teen was close enough to hear him between the foot falls of giants and the distance between them.
"Get them from behind!" He shouts steadily, though his body is already beginning to glow again, charging up for a move in preparation for whatever will come.
